Team,

Handover on Plowline, the farm-equipment telemetry gateway: ingest lag resolved after vacuuming the readings table. Retention job re-enabled. Watch replication lag on the standby this week — it spiked twice. Failover runbook unchanged. For direct access to the telemetry primary, use the connection string below.

warehouse DSN: mssql://quenir_svc:SvJukdQ74VnW1L@db-151e.ferraworks.corp:5432/raldor

// Broker upgrade notes for plugin authors:
// Quillbus 4.x replaces the legacy 3.x wire protocol. Plugins must
// construct the client with explicit protocol negotiation enabled,
// or connections to the Larkfield cluster will be silently downgraded
// and dropped after 30s. Topic names are unchanged. For local testing
// against the sandbox broker, authenticate with the key below.

API key for bafof-bagaf: qvz2-qi

### Vendor Note: Read-Replica Lag Alarm

Our managed database vendor, Copperfen Systems, operates the read replicas backing the Tollgate reporting service. Their lag alarm fires when replication delay exceeds 90 seconds; during release windows this can trigger falsely due to bulk migrations. Before holding a release, confirm with Copperfen whether the alarm reflects genuine lag or migration noise. They commit to a 30-minute response during business hours. To reach their support desk, use the address below.

alerts address for kajog-tadup: druox@plorvanet.internal

Checklist item 7: Confirm the Driftnet orphaned-resource sweeper ran within the last 24 hours and that its summary report lists zero unresolved orphans in the Calderro staging environment. Support staff should verify that quarantined resources were held for the full 14-day grace period before deletion, and that owners were notified through the Pigeonhole queue. Do not manually delete flagged resources; the sweeper handles cleanup on its next pass. Escalations about missed sweeps go to the person named below.

account owner for bawip-tahag: Raleth Quenok

**Vendor note: Inkmill markdown pipeline**

Rendering for Parchway docs is outsourced to Inkmill under an annual contract, renewing each March. They handle sanitization and PDF export; we own the upload queue. SLA: 4-hour response on rendering failures. Escalate only after two failed retries. Their support desk is reachable at the address below.

billing contact of hahaf-baguf = zorael.tammir.jorius@sivrelhq.internal